A correlation of hot firing nozzle flow separation data with existing theories in side loads is presented, resulting in a simple method of estimating nozzle side loads. The tendency of a configuration to produce side loads and their approximate magnitudes is predicted. The model has additional value for the consideration of nozzle modifications to reduce side loads. Results of hot firing tests at NASA George C. Marshall Space Flight Center with these modifications are presented.
